Makeup with contact lenses – you should pay attention to this when choosing a product!

Women who prefer to wear contact lenses instead of glasses should take a closer look when choosing their make-up utensils. This is because conventional products often crumble quickly and small particles of mascara and the like can quickly get into the eye and, in the worst case, cause irritation. We give tips on what you should pay attention to when choosing your cosmetics, especially if you have sensitive eyes.

  • Avoids ingredients such as alcohol, perfume, starch and proteins that are totally unsuitable for contact lenses, eyes and skin. You should also avoid preservatives.
  • Suitable for contact lens wearers are purely vegetable ingredients and dyes that are particularly well tolerated by the skin, eyes and contact lenses.
  • The ingredients should care for the sensitive area around the eyes and should not deposit in the eyes, on the skin or on contact lenses. To prevent skin and eye irritation, pH-neutral products are important.
  • Care products should also be water-soluble so that they cannot create a greasy film on the contact lenses.
  • Makeup products for the eyes should not be waterproof. These cosmetics can crumble easily. It is best to use a smudge-proof, non-crumbling make-up, for example cream eye shadow. Contact lens wearers should use ultra-micronized eye cosmetics: With this make-up, the individual particles are so small that they do not irritate the eye wearing contact lenses.

Makeup with contact lenses – The best tips and tricks

With eyeshadow, eyeliner etc. the eyes can be perfectly set in scene, for example with smokey eyes. If you want to do without your glasses, you should pay attention to these ten points when applying make-up with contact lenses. This avoids irritation and irritation of the eyes and lids and protects the contact lenses.

  1. Insert contact lenses before applying make-up.
  2. When applying eye make-up, start with eye shadow, use cream eye shadow or eye shadow powder.
  3. This is followed by eyeliner or kohl pencil and finally mascara.
  4. Kajal should not be applied to the inner edge of the eyelids.
  5. Do not apply cream immediately before inserting the lenses. The lotion could leave a thin film on your lenses.
  6. Always use hairspray before inserting contact lenses.
  7. Ideally, remove contact lenses before using hairspray. Otherwise, close your eyes while spraying and keep them closed for a short while afterwards.
  8. Also when applying nail polish, make sure that no polish vapors reach the eyes.
  9. Important: When blow-drying, make sure that the eyes do not become too dry (blink frequently).
  10. Remove the lenses before removing make-up. It is best to use oil-free make-up removers or water-soluble cleaning emulsions.
